Chronic Tinnitus: An Overlooked Disability

Chronic tinnitus, the persistent ringing or buzzing in the ears, is a condition that affects millions of people worldwide. While it may seem like a minor inconvenience to some, for those who suffer from it daily, it can be a debilitating disability. The constant noise can make it difficult to concentrate, sleep, and even carry out daily tasks. Unfortunately, chronic tinnitus is often overlooked as a disability, leading to a lack of understanding and support for those who are affected by it.

One of the main reasons why chronic tinnitus should be recognized as a disability is the profound impact it can have on a person’s quality of life. The constant noise can lead to feelings of frustration, anxiety, and even depression. The inability to escape the ringing in their ears can make it challenging for individuals to focus on tasks at work or enjoy social interactions. This can result in decreased productivity, isolation, and overall decreased well-being. Recognizing chronic tinnitus as a disability can open up avenues for proper accommodations and support for those who are struggling to cope with this condition.

Furthermore, chronic tinnitus can also lead to physical health issues such as fatigue, headaches, and increased stress levels. The constant strain of trying to ignore the ringing in their ears can take a toll on a person’s overall health and well-being. Recognizing chronic tinnitus as a disability can help individuals access the resources and treatments they need to manage their symptoms and improve their quality of life. This acknowledgment can also lead to increased awareness and research into finding better solutions and therapies for those living with chronic tinnitus.
